Circuit/System Testing

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2009 Saturn Vue.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
  1. Ignition OFF, open the hood to disable the Auto-Stop function.
  2. Ignition ON, verify the scan tool hood position parameter displays Open.
    • If the hood position does not display Open, refer to DTC P254F .
  3. Ignition OFF, disconnect the harness connector at the appropriate KS.
  4. Ignition ON, test for 2-3 V between the signal circuit terminal 1 and ground.
    • If less than the specified range, test the signal circuit for a short to ground or an open/high resistance. If the circuits/connections test normal, replace the ECM.
    • If greater than the specified range, test the signal circuit for a short to voltage. If the circuits/connections test normal, replace the ECM.
  5. Test for 2-3 V between the low reference circuit terminal 2 and ground.
    • If less than the specified range, test the low reference circuit for a short to ground or an open/high resistance. If the circuits/connections test normal, replace the ECM.
    • If greater than the specified range, test the low reference circuit for a short to voltage. If the circuits/connections test normal, replace the ECM.
  6. If all circuits/connections test normal, test or replace the KS sensor.
